Jack Harrell, sometimes credited as Jack L. Harrell, is an actor and voice-over announcer who voiced the droning Mr. Harold Heffer in the Dinosaurs episode "What "Sexual" Harris Meant." He also provided the narration for the animated Sesame Street insert "The Noble Ostrich."

Harrell was a regular on Cher's television show, playing butlers and businessmen. Harrell was also the original announcer for The People's Court from 1981 to 1993. Other TV credits include guest spots on Night Court, Step by Step, and Walker, Texas Ranger.
